Unhappy Air bag light

My air bag light has decided to start blinking, and then stays on.
I just want to know why?

99 250 5.4

Count the blinks. It'll have two series of flashes. For example, it'll flash twice, then pause, then flash six times. That's a code 26. It will repeat the code a few times. The code will tell you what the problem is. You'll probably still have to take it to the dealer to get it fixed though. Here's some codes:

12 Low Battery Voltage
13 Air Bag Circuit or Crash Sensor Circuit - Shorted to Ground
15 Driver's Air Bag Sensor Fault.
21 Safing Sensor - Not Mounted on Vehicle Properly
22 Safing Sensor Output Circuit - Shorted to Battery Voltage
23 Safing Sensor Input Feed/Return Circuit Open
24 Open in Circuit 944B or Low Resistance in Crash Sensor(s)
25 Passenger de-activation switch error.
32 Driver Side Air Bag/Safing Sensor Circuit - High Resistance or Open
33 Pin 7 Not Grounded at Diagnostic Monitor
34 Driver Side Air Bag/Safing Sensor Circuit - Low Resistance or Shorted
35 Low Resistance Across Pins 8 and 9 at Diagnostic Monitor
41 Crash Sensor Circuit - High Resistance or Open
44 RH Crash Sensor - Not Mounted to Vehicle Properly
45 Center Radiator Crash Sensor - Not Mounted to Vehicle Properly
46 LH Crash Sensor - Not Mounted to Vehicle Properly
51 Diagnostic Monitor Internal Thermal Fuse - Blown and Short to Ground No Longer Exists
52 Backup Power Supply - Voltage Boost Fault
53 Internal Diagnostic Monitor Fault

Air bag light code 27

DONT TAKE IT TO THE DEALER!!
I had the same code 27 in my 99 F250. The code 27 means the lightbulb in the passenger shut off is burnt out. At the factory ford decided to put 12 volts to a 3-4 volt light bulb. Use this link to fix your problem.

I had the same problem on my 1999 F-250 V-10 4x4. I had a friend who could get it to the dealer to have the code checked. It was free for me but usually $80.00. Turned out to be the bulb in the passanger side air bag mod. Problem with that was they don't sell just the bulb for that. I had to buy a resister that had the bulb in it. It's an easy fix, pull out the old, where the passanger air bag switch is, bring to dealer and get a new one. It plugs right in. The resister was about $80.00 I was told the dealer would have charged me over $300.00 to do the same thing.
